The 10 Most Common Mistakes
1. Last-Minute Organization
Mistake: Organizing 2-3 days beforehand
Solution: Start at least 2 weeks in advance
2. Budget Ambiguity
Mistake: Not giving a clear budget
Solution: Say, e.g., "$30-$40 range"
3. Drawing Yourself Problem
Mistake: Someone draws themselves in the physical draw
Solution: Use an online platform, it automatically prevents it
4. Failing to Maintain Secrecy
Mistake: Telling who you bought for
Solution: Keep your mouth shut!
5. Inappropriate Gift
Mistake: Personal, intimate, or offensive gift
Solution: Choose universal and neutral gifts
6. Low Quality
Mistake: Very cheap, broken, or dirty gift
Solution: Choose high-quality but budget-friendly
7. Late Participation
Mistake: Request to join at the last minute
Solution: Set a participation deadline
8. Forgetting the Gift on Party Day
Mistake: Forgetting
Solution: Send a reminder the day before
9. Overly Expensive Gift
Mistake: Buying a gift 2x the budget
Solution: Stick to the budget, don't embarrass anyone
